Firstly, Production I.G and Masamune Shirow's earlier partnership spawned one of the classic anime films, namely 'Ghost in the Shell' of course, and now they re-team for an adaptation of Shirow's manga 'Ghost Hound'; which actually begins its manga serialisation this month. That's nice - what's more, the Director is Ryutaro Nakamura, the man responsible for the astonishing 'Kino's Journey' (as we know it from the American DVD release; great cheapo set of that out there now) and the legendary oddness that is 'Serial Experiments Lain'. Scripting comes from 'Lain' writer Chiaki Konaka. It's due Fall 2007 - Q4 if you prefer.

Secondly, Yasuomi Umetsu makes a rare appearance with another production based around his 'Kite' franchise. Now, there's two previous incarnations based around this which differ in key aspects. There's the slightly dodgy hentai variant, 'A Kite' as it's sometimes known, a dark two-parter (I think; it's been some time) with hardcore scenes in it, involving a young lady of questionable maturity. Still, it's a damn fine action piece with actually only a couple of hentai moments, in reality. The other incarnation of a character from 'A Kite' comes in the more mainstream (but still orange catsuit-laden) 'Mezzo Forte' TV Series. This new 'Kite : Liberator' looks like the former, and although it's both admirable and vaguely dodgy to admit a liking for that original, I am proud to say I think it's a semi-obscure anime gem.... that's a little bit pornographic.

I also think brief mentions deserved for Shinchiro Watanabe's new feature 'Baby Blue'; man behind 'Cowboy Bebop'. Upcoming on R1 USA DVD is the classical horror tales series 'Ayakashi', which has a spin-off called 'Mononoke' due this Summer. And since Scott Green gives the superb-looking 'The Girl Who Leapt Through Time' a good review, I will say I had hoped for subtitles on the Japanese release, now have fingers crossed it will appear in America after winning some decent awards... at the Tokyo Anime Fair Awards; Best Director, Best Script, Art Direction, and Character Design.
